In terms of brewing, I have seen folks keeping things cool by putting the carboy into a larger sized bucket of water, swap out ice or ice packs daily or more often if you live in a very hot place, and drape a wet towel around the shoulder of the carboy. For added cooling, you could point a fan at this whole setup. I had a friend do this in his basement to brew a lager. It worked surprisingly well. |
